Streamlabs OBS Download For PC Windows 10 64 bit Updated Version

By | November 30, 2023

Streamlabs OBS Download For PC Windows 10 64 bit Latest Version

Streamlabs OBS Download For PC Windows 10 64 bit is a popular and powerful software solution designed for content creators, streamers, and gamers who want to broadcast, record, and share their content online. Streamlabs OBS Download for PC Windows 10 64 bit is a version of this software optimized for the Windows 10 operating system with 64-bit architecture. It combines the best features of OBS Studio (Open Broadcaster Software) with added functionality and user-friendly tools to simplify the process of live streaming and content creation. In this comprehensive article, we will explore Streamlabs OBS for Windows 10 64 bit, including its purpose, key features, recent updates, system requirements, installation process, and the advantages it offers to content creators.

Streamlabs OBS Download for PC Windows 10 64 bit serves a crucial purpose in the world of content creation, live streaming, and gaming. Its primary functions can be summarized as follows:

  1. Live Streaming: The software is designed to enable users to live stream their content to popular platforms such as Twitch, YouTube, Facebook Gaming, and more. Streamers can showcase their gameplay, interact with viewers in real time, and build a dedicated audience.
  2. Content Creation: Streamlabs OBS provides a comprehensive platform for creating and recording content, including gameplay, tutorials, podcasts, and vlogs. It allows users to enhance the production value of their content with overlays, alerts, and interactive elements.

Streamlabs OBS Download For PC Windows 10 64 bit Updated Version

Streamlabs OBS Download For PC Windows 10 64 bit Updated Version

Direct Link

Key Features

Streamlabs OBS Download For PC Windows 10 64 bit offers a wide range of features that cater to the needs of content creators and streamers. Here are nine key features, each explained in detail:

  1. User-Friendly Interface: Streamlabs OBS boasts an intuitive and user-friendly interface that makes it accessible to both beginners and experienced streamers. Users can easily navigate and customize their streaming setup.
  2. Scene and Source Management: The software allows users to create multiple scenes and add various sources to each scene. Sources can include webcam feeds, game captures, browser windows, and more, providing flexibility in content presentation.
  3. Customizable Overlays: Streamlabs OBS offers customizable overlay templates, alert boxes, and widgets that users can add to their streams. These elements can enhance the visual appeal of streams and engage viewers.
  4. Live Chat Integration: The software integrates with popular chat platforms, allowing streamers to monitor and interact with their audience in real time, fostering a sense of community.
  5. Advanced Audio Controls: Streamlabs OBS provides detailed audio controls, enabling users to fine-tune audio sources, adjust volume levels, and apply filters for professional sound quality.
  6. Scene Transitions: Users can choose from a variety of scene transition effects, creating smooth and engaging transitions between scenes in their streams or recordings.
  7. Multistreaming: Streamlabs OBS supports multistreaming, allowing users to simultaneously broadcast their content to multiple streaming platforms, expanding their reach and audience.
  8. Dynamic Alerts: The software includes dynamic alert notifications for events such as new followers, donations, or chat interactions. These alerts can be customized to match the stream’s branding.
  9. Stream Recording: Users can record their streams locally for later editing or uploading to platforms like YouTube. Streamlabs OBS offers various recording options, including different resolutions and bitrates.

What’s New?

The latest version of Streamlabs OBS For PC introduces several new features and improvements. Here are five noteworthy additions:

  • Enhanced Performance: The new version includes performance optimizations, ensuring smoother streaming and recording experiences, even on lower-end hardware.
  • Streamlabs Cloud: The updated software offers integration with Streamlabs Cloud, allowing users to save and sync their settings and scenes across devices.
  • Virtual Camera Support: Streamlabs OBS now supports virtual camera output, making it easier to use the software with virtual meeting platforms like Zoom or Microsoft Teams.
  • Advanced Plugins: The new version includes advanced plugin support, allowing users to extend the software’s functionality with custom plugins and integrations.
  • Improved Chat Moderation: Streamlabs OBS includes improved chat moderation tools, making it easier for streamers to manage their chat and maintain a positive community.

System Requirements

Before downloading and installing Streamlabs OBS Download for PC Windows 10 64 bit, it’s essential to ensure that your computer meets the minimum system requirements for optimal performance. Here are the system requirements:

  • Operating System: Windows 10 (64-bit).
  • Processor: Intel Core i5 CPU with at least four cores.
  • RAM: 8 GB of RAM or more.
  • Graphics Card: Graphics card with DirectX 10.1 support or higher.
  • Storage: At least 4 GB of free disk space.
  • Internet Connection: A stable internet connection with sufficient upload bandwidth for live streaming.

Please note that higher-end hardware specifications may be necessary for more demanding streams, such as high-resolution or high-framerate content.

How to Install?

Installing Streamlabs OBS Latest Version for PC Windows 10 64 bit is a straightforward process. Follow these brief steps to get started:

  1. Download: Visit the official Streamlabs OBS website to download the installer for Windows 10 64 bit.
  2. Installation: Run the downloaded installer file and follow the on-screen instructions to install Streamlabs OBS on your computer.
  3. Account Setup: Launch Streamlabs OBS and follow the prompts to create or log in to your Streamlabs account. This account will be used to access additional features and services.
  4. Scene and Source Configuration: Configure your scenes and sources within Streamlabs OBS to customize your streaming setup.
  5. Audio and Video Settings: Adjust your audio and video settings, including bitrate, resolution, and frame rate, to match your streaming preferences and system capabilities.
  6. Overlay Customization: Customize your overlays, alerts, and widgets to match your branding and engage your audience effectively.
  7. Testing and Going Live: Test your setup by recording or streaming privately before going live to ensure everything is working as expected. When ready, click the “Go Live” button to start your stream.


In conclusion, Streamlabs OBS Download For PC Windows 10 64 bit is a powerful and versatile software solution that empowers content creators, streamers, and gamers to create high-quality streams and content effortlessly. With its user-friendly interface, customizable features, and integration with popular streaming platforms, Streamlabs OBS simplifies the process of live streaming and content creation.

The latest version of Streamlabs OBS introduces performance enhancements, cloud integration, virtual camera support, advanced plugins, and improved chat moderation tools, ensuring that users have access to the latest tools and features for an exceptional streaming experience.

Whether you’re a seasoned streamer looking to enhance your production value or a newcomer eager to share your content with the world, Streamlabs OBS provides the tools and capabilities to make your streams engaging, professional, and successful. Download Streamlabs OBS for PC Windows 10 64 bit today and unlock the full potential of your content creation and streaming endeavors.

Leave a Reply

Your email address will not be published. Required fields are marked *